Although I do not know how to stop App_GlobalResources automatically generationg assemblies in Temporary ASP.NET files. I did figure out how to get rid of those annoying warnings.

As the warning says:

Compiler Error Message: CS0433: The type 'Resources.XXXX' exists in both 'c:\Windows\Microsoft.NET\Framework64\v4.0.30319\Temporary ASP.NET Files\root\6c657d01\aaca70ae\assembly\dl3\a36dac65\78c87110_3724cb01\Resources.DLL' and 'c:\Windows\Microsoft.NET\Framework64\v4.0.30319\Temporary ASP.NET Files\root\6c657d01\aaca70ae\App_GlobalResources.g6fehiio.dll'

The type Resources.XXXX exists in both assemblies. Change your Custom Tool Namespace to be something other than "Resources" and these warnings will dissappear.

  1. Move the .resx to another folder (not App_GlobalResources)
  2. Keep the Custom Tool Namespace set to 'Resources'
